The Office of Public Engagement engages external stakeholders on behalf of the Secretary working closely with the Operating Administrations and government agencies to create and coordinate opportunities for direct dialogue between the Administration and the American public on the Bipartisan Infrastructure Law (BIL), known as the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act. The BIL provides the U.S. Department of Transportation $660 billion over five years between FY 2022 through FY 2026.
